Public folders underneath private spaces inherit sharing permissions from the private space.
I've shared the space with Teams ONLY, no individual users.
Yet, the sharing modal currently works to actually inherit the individual users that are part of those teams to also be shown as individual people within the sharing modal as well.
Feedback from the support team added below:
Why individual users appear in the sharing modal
This is currently how the sharing modal behaves for public locations. Even though those users are members of a Team that's been added, the modal renders them as individual entries rather than grouping them under their Team. It's a UX limitation, not a sign that someone manually shared with those users individually. When you switch a location (Folder) to private, the modal shows the cleaner Team-grouped view you're expecting.
Your assumption about inheritance
You're correct. Public locations under a private Space inherit the same access as the Space. So if your Space is private and shared with specific Teams, the public Folders, Lists, and tasks within it are accessible to those same Teams. No additional permission changes are needed for that setup.
Getting to clean Team-only sharing
For the cleanest view, the key is to set your locations to private and share them explicitly with your Teams. That way, the sharing modal will reflect exactly what you expect: Teams only, no individual user clutter. Just be aware that if anyone has been individually shared at any level (Folder, List, or task), that override will persist even after you restructure, so it's worth spot-checking a few locations after making changes.
